Size Acceptance Organization Awards McDonalds Corporation
The International Size Acceptance Association issues its first annual "Size Friendly Business Award" to the McDonald's Corporation. ISAA bases this award on McDonald's efforts to create a healthy restaurant environment for consumers.
AUSTIN, TX (PRWEB) May 22, 2005 -- The International Size Acceptance Association (ISAA) has issued its first Size Friendly Business Award" to the McDonalds Corporation, coinciding with ISAAs seventh annual International Size Acceptance Day and McDonalds 50th anniversary. ISAA awarded McDonalds based on the corporations introduction of healthier food choices into its menus, installation of size appropriate seating" into its restaurants and McDonalds long tradition of having playscapes to encourage activity in children.
ISAAs core concept is 'Respect Fitness Health and we want to recognize businesses that implement this concept," said Allen Steadham, ISAAs Founder and Director. We believe that the McDonalds Corporation has committed to promoting health and responsibility in creating a positive environment for consumers of all sizes."
ISAA awarded the McDonalds Corporation with a plaque, which was sent to McDonalds Department of Corporate Responsibility. McDonalds representatives thanked ISAA for issuing the award to McDonalds.
ISAAs mission is to promote size acceptance and help end weight-based discrimination throughout the world by means of advocacy and visible, lawful actions. ISAA has representatives in the United States, Canada, Brazil, the UK, France, the Philippines, the Middle East, Australia and New Zealand.
ISAA was founded in 1997 in Austin, Texas.
